Buy Ferrari Part # 61518693 2686224800 TAPPETO TESTA DI MORO GD.(New Part #61518693) Buy Ferrari Spares

$57.38

Product Description

Ferrari Part 61518693 2686224800 TAPPETO TESTA DI MORO GD.(New Part #61518693)